The Asia Pacific regional headquarters of NEC Corporation (Japan), announced earlier this month that it will be integrated with another NEC branch office in the Philippines – NEC Corporation Manila Branch.
The NEC Corporation Manila Branch which specializes in providing carrier network solutions and services, will become a business unit of NEC Philippines. Mr Kiyofumi Kusaka, the current President at NEC Philippines, will retain in his position.
This realignment of NEC’s operations in the Philippines is in line with the “œOne NEC” concept listed in the Mid-Term Growth Plan set by NEC Corporation, which seeks to realign and integrate its regional subsidiaries so as to establish a stronger presence in their respective regions, and in compliance with corporate governance policies. Asia Pacific will cover nine countries including Australia, India, Indonesia, Malaysia, New Zealand, Philippines, Singapore, Thailand, and Vietnam.
